**Key Ceremony — Item 4: GarageLine Feed Signing**

Confirm the Stackport occupancy feed publisher key is rotated before re-signing. Verify feed checksums from the last 24 hours match the Ledgerhall archive. Abort if any mismatch. After rotation, unlock the escrow module using the recovery passphrase below.

unlock words, yawig-kagef: gordor-holvan-ulaael-pramir-ulaiel-tamdor

Timeline entry, Patchwork Payroll incident. 09:14 — Marisol noticed the nightly export to Crestbook was rejected; turns out their parser now expects semicolon-delimited fields instead of tabs. 09:40 — We rolled a quick formatter shim in the export worker. 10:05 — Re-ran the batch; two test tenants confirmed clean imports. 10:30 — Full rerun kicked off for all of the Ostergate region. Nobody got paid late, but let's add a format contract test so this doesn't sneak up again. The fixed build is tagged below.

session token of tajef-bageg = htk21_5d90d574934f3ccae6437

Re: Retirement of the Stonebriar product line

Stonebriar sales have declined for five consecutive quarters and support costs now exceed contribution margin. The retirement plan is staged: new orders close end of Q2, existing contracts honoured through their terms, and spares stocked for twenty-four months. Sales leads should steer prospects toward the Ashgrove range; migration incentives are already approved. Customer comms are drafted and awaiting legal sign-off. The forward strategy behind this decision is set out in the note below.

confidential, yafog-hagug: Gross margin on Druix came in at 10 percent against a plan of 15 percent. Only 5 of the 80 pilot accounts renewed Druix, so a churn review is set for October 1.

Subject: Quickstore 4.2 — bloom filter now fronts the KV layer

Plugin authors: starting with this release, Quickstore places a bloom filter ahead of the key-value store. Negative lookups return faster; false positives fall through safely. No API changes are required on your side. Verify your plugin against the staging build referenced below.

session token of fahif-tadup = htk3_9c7